Arman is a member of the firm's General Litigation practice group. He focuses his practice on white collar defense and investigations as well as commercial disputes. Arman also maintains an active pro bono practice, centered on immigration and civil rights litigation.
Arman earned his J.D. from Columbia Law School. During law school, he was an extern at the Criminal Defense Practice of the Neighborhood Defender Service of Harlem, and at the Legal Aid Society. He also participated in Columbia's Entrepreneurship and Community Development Clinic. Arman also served as a Notes Editor for the Columbia Human Rights Law Review and Staff Editor for the Jailhouse Lawyer's Manual.
